Destination Imagination and Lumen Technologies have teamed up to bring you
the imagineXperience. The imagineXperience was created to help K-12 students
living in underserved communities recover from pandemic-induced
instructional loss and build the critical skills they will need to thrive in
the digital economy of the future. Qualifying teams use research,
storytelling, and technology to create digital solutions to a unique
challenge meant to push their boundaries, work together and have fun. On
average, imagineXperience participants have shown a positive increase in
their confidence to express ideas, present in front of groups, work in
teams, as well as the confidence to explore subjects such as computer
science, AI, and robotics.

 

Thanks to the generous support of Lumen Technologies, all registration fees
are covered in full. Beyond that, qualifying organizations can receive up to
$500 in additional support funding for every team that they host.

 

Students in K-12 are eligible to participate in teams of 5-7 students.  The
challenge will begin in January with solutions submitted in mid-March.

 

The CHALLENGE is to create an original story showing an encounter of a
Notable Enigma by an Innovator from history. Add in an Intelligent Gizmo to
help assist in the encounter and present the story in the style of a
Docudrama Video.
